[QUOTE="magic kat, post: 3020011"] I am working on a web based asp.net 2.0 project that began as an application in Visual Studio 2005. The web site appears to work okay, but when we attempt to build it, we get all sorts of errors. The answer I get from the developer is "don't build it". I am not so sure this is a good idea, isn't that the whole idea, that building it gives us any errors that are bound to come haunt us somewhere down the line. What do you think the repercussions would be if we continued to work on this "Web project" that started as an App -- it has designer files in it and everything. [/QUOTE]
